2021 Regular Session
HB514   by Representative Tanner Magee      

TAX/SALES & USE:  Provides for the dedication of certain vehicle sales and use taxes (EN -$296,000,000 GF RV See Note)

Current Status:  Signed by the Governor - Act 486
